      The average temperature in Seattle in September is around 17°C. The warmest month in Seattle is typically August, which averages 25°C. The coolest month is January, with temperatures averaging 4°C. The rainiest month is December, and it usually rains the least in July.

      Flying to Seattle: what you need to know

      Getting to central Seattle from Seattle / Tacoma International Airport (SEA)

      • Central Seattle is about 23 kilometres from SEA, the city's main airport.

      • Once you've landed from your flight to Seattle, the drive to the centre takes around 25 minutes.

      • Roughly 35 minutes is how long it'll take to get there on public transport.
